Explore printable Rotational Kinetic Energy worksheets
Rotational kinetic energy worksheets available through Wayground (formerly Quizizz) provide comprehensive practice for students studying this fundamental concept in physics. These educational resources focus on developing students' understanding of how rotating objects store energy based on their moment of inertia and angular velocity, with problems covering spheres, cylinders, disks, and other rotating systems. The worksheets strengthen critical problem-solving skills through systematic practice with the rotational kinetic energy formula, unit conversions, and real-world applications involving flywheels, spinning wheels, and rotating machinery.
